Output 39abae05a21cc6144bd2316b893cd66def886e8aa27ce87971412848788d0cb5:39

value
3623178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542f52fc524dda09709433521e0a6440ca633aa2 OP_EQUAL
address
39N9NoEdkL45H6kYoQNjthdyNqLgNqtSyQ
transaction
39abae05a21cc6144bd2316b893cd66def886e8aa27ce87971412848788d0cb5
spent
true